Hey guys
I am new to the site and i have a question for everyone. I am soon going to be buying a diesel pickup. I have two to decide from. 1st is a 2008 Chevy 2500HD,LTZ, crew cab short box 4x4, its white with tan interior, its the LMM duramax with the Allison, this is my Dads old truck and he wants to get rid of it. I like it because no DEF fluid, It has the mini max, bushwhackers, and a goose neck already. Now the other choice is a 2013 F-350, Platinum, crew cab, short box, 4x4 with a locker in the rear, white with black interior, This has the new 6.7 Powerstroke and gets better mileage then the Chevy and has more power but has DEF. The Ford would be brand new and loaded(Nav, heated seats, ETC...)Chevy would be used but from a family member so not a big deal.(chevy has heated seats and bose for options The Ford would need full deletes on the exhaust and a good tuner for sure. The chevy already has the deletes and a tuner. They both seem about the same of power now(chevy- modded, ford-stock). Now what would you guys recommend ? I like the ford but it doesn't handle as well as the chevy, but chevy has once given us trouble off road. I would also do a leveling kit and run 35s on both. What would i need to do the make the chevy fast but still reliable? What would i need to do to the ford to make it handle better ?

Most important try and sell me what one to buy and what i should do to make it loud and proud !

What do you mean when the LMM stacks up against other duramax motors ? I our family plows snow and the trucks that we have had with DEF fluid freeze up. Then the re-gen cycle kicks on and limits power until it has been burned off at speeds of 45+ which is a pain because we have to drive to the next town over for it to burn off then we get another 3 hours of plowing until we have to do the same thing. The deletes have been cleared by my local Ford dealer for is reason and i will be able to keep my warranty if all deletes are installed by them.
